tmp-postgres-0.1.0.8: test/Database/Postgres/Temp/InternalSpec.hs
{-# LANGUAGE OverloadedStrings, DeriveDataTypeable #-}
module Database.Postgres.Temp.InternalSpec (main, spec) where
import Test.Hspec
import System.IO.Temp
import Database.Postgres.Temp.Internal
import Data.Typeable
import Control.Exception
import System.IO
import System.Directory
import Control.Monad
import System.Process
import Database.PostgreSQL.Simple
import qualified Data.ByteString.Char8 as BSC
import System.Exit
import Control.Applicative ((<$>))
main :: IO ()
main = hspec spec
mkDevNull :: IO Handle
mkDevNull = openFile "/dev/null" WriteMode
data Except = Except
deriving (Show, Eq, Typeable)
instance Exception Except
countPostgresProcesses :: IO Int
countPostgresProcesses = length . lines <$> readProcess "pgrep" ["postgres"] []
spec :: Spec
spec = describe "Database.Postgres.Temp.Internal" $ do
before (createTempDirectory "/tmp" "tmp-postgres") $ after rmDirIgnoreErrors $ describe "startWithLogger/stop" $ do
forM_ [minBound .. maxBound] $ \event ->
it ("deletes the temp dir and postgres on exception in " ++ show event) $ \mainFilePath -> do
-- This is not the best method ... but it works
beforePostgresCount <- countPostgresProcesses
shouldThrow
(startWithLogger (\currentEvent -> when (currentEvent == event) $ throwIO Except) [] mainFilePath stdout stderr)
(\Except -> True)
doesDirectoryExist mainFilePath `shouldReturn` False
countPostgresProcesses `shouldReturn` beforePostgresCount
it "creates a useful connection string and stop still cleans up" $ \mainFilePath -> do
beforePostgresCount <- countPostgresProcesses
stdOut <- mkDevNull
stdErr <- mkDevNull
result <- startWithLogger (\_ -> return ()) [] mainFilePath stdOut stdErr
db <- case result of
Right x -> return x
Left err -> error $ show err
conn <- connectPostgreSQL $ BSC.pack $ connectionString db
_ <- execute_ conn "create table users (id int)"
stop db `shouldReturn` ExitSuccess
doesDirectoryExist mainFilePath `shouldReturn` False
countPostgresProcesses `shouldReturn` beforePostgresCount
it "can override settings" $ \_ -> do
let expectedDuration = "100ms"
bracket (start [("log_min_duration_statement", expectedDuration)])
(either (\_ -> return ()) (void . stop)) $ \result -> do
db <- case result of
Right x -> return x
Left err -> error $ show err
conn <- connectPostgreSQL $ BSC.pack $ connectionString db
[Only actualDuration] <- query_ conn "SHOW log_min_duration_statement"
actualDuration `shouldBe` expectedDuration
